US Airways Makes Last Stand at Philadelphia Hub
Discount airline Southwest begins service out of Philadelphia Sunday, moving into territory long ruled by embattled US Airways. The latter fights back with a marketing blitz aimed at winning customers through cheap fares and colorful gimmicks. NPR's Jack Speer reports.

A Brief, Private Trip into Space
A small company funded by Microsoft billionaire Paul Allen will attempt to send a person into space aboard a vehicle called SpaceShipOne. It's one of more than 20 groups competing for a $10 million prize for the first non-governmental manned space flight. NPR's David Kestenbaum reports.
